2 out of 5 stars Too New Age to be anything new   July 27, 2008
This book has great reviews, and I can't for the life of me see why. It's not a terrible book, of course, it hits a lot of the same ground that most new age books do. But it came so highly recommended to me that I was terribly dissappointed to find so much rehashing of worn out material. The book has good points, but nearly each one is outweighed by negative points. Example:

Positives:

The book is well written. It gives good examples to illustrate it's subjects.

Negatives:

There are so many examples that the substance of each lesson is all-but lost in the meandering illustrations making it hard to read. I felt the rare urge to skip ahead, something I never do. But in this case it was all but irresistable.

I don't want to belittle the text since so many people find it useful and enjoyable. But I do want to give fair warning. If you know anything about auras, chakras, astral projection, and similar subjects, you are unlikely to learn much that is new here. And the presentation of this material is handled far better in the works of people like Robert Bruce.

5 out of 5 stars Awesome Book on Tantric Buddhist and Occult Thought   February 15, 2005
 14 out of 14 found this review helpful


This is an awesome book on Tantric Buddhism and the occult under Buddhist thought, one grid of measurement in the sea of beneficial blueprints to view humanity and reality under. In this T. Lobsand Rampa goes into the idea of human body and the atomistic view in its relation to smaller and higher forms of matter, the etheric and magnetic fields, the aura and it's colors, the wave fields of telepathy, clairvoyance and psychometry along with other waves of of existence in all matter.

Written as a mail order course combined into a book format, lessons are conveyed on how to understand and read the auric sheath, it's colors, the ability to see the etheric and aura fields, escaping the limitations of the body through meditative practices beyond thought and conceptual thinking, intuitively feeling existence. In this are out of body auric experiences, the auric body travel while dreaming while attached by a psychic silver cord. How life as we know it is a school of suffering for growth towards higher existence beyond our incarnations of existence through reincarnation.

In order to grow psychically, one has to leave the highs and the lows of thinking in moodiness of euporhia and depression to that of the sound stable waves of inner composure and calmness. Our minds consist of electrical waves when kept level and balance exist for us in an inner peace with calm faith in the universal laws of karma where we can maintain a peaceful inner existence which induces our psychic abilities of telepathic hearing, clairvoyant visions and the psychometric ability to feel the vibrational frequencies of history in objects, places, things and people. And there is reading the Akashic Record which contains the knowledge of all history.

And T. Lobsand Rampa expounds on the act of giving, forgiving and letting go of anger and fear. This includes practices of breathing and balance of non-thinking that lets go of anger and emotional turmoils. To continue fear anger and anxiety is to run an engine in lower gear going the same speed.

There is mentioned self-hypnosis to the subconscious, to train our minds to do as we wish. The wisdom is in living in a peaceful state of kindness, tolerance, understanding and balance beyond all the petty concerns of the physical competition, of the constant clinging and aversions of the materialistic and ignorant. Generosity, agape, tithing to your causes are essential. I really enjoyed these spiritual principles. It makes me smile at the ignorance of the monotheists and Christians that condemn the occult, while these teachings endorse the only acts of receiving are through giving, an attitude and life of service to others.

There are no doctrines, no religious dogmas, but the endorsement to let people have their own philosophies, religions and doctrines, unless of course the reader is dogmatic about these teachings or any other he or she reads.
